Verifying leaks uncovers “fake leaks”

Posted on December 27, 2014 by Dissent

Posted by @Cyber_War_News to Pastebin today:

Now after working with data leaks for years now it became clearly obvious to me that this was fake. why?
because real leaks do not get combined real leaks often have a common format the targets attacked have accounts leaked daily from phishing and other simple methods.

So i tried to call out @AnonymousGlobo after Kevin mitnick had posted and was confused by this leak then reporters for @AFP were trying to contact this “hacker”.

Enough is enough of these fakes leaks and when AnonymousGlobo was asked about this i was told “stop speaking bullshit”… so to make sure i wasn’t speaking bullshit i did the following and broke up the leak, searched and found basically ALL traces of it going back to as far as 2011.
